Norm Hare 907837 Posted April 23, 2006 at 12:05 PM Posted April 23, 2006 at 12:05 PM Depending on age and manufacturer of the laptop, it may not have the available video ram to display properly. Many laptops used shared memory (ie...video ram is actually a portion of the 512mb ram). You may want to go to the manufacture's website and see if they offer any solutions to your problem.
